AEW’s Nigel McGuinness has commented on his upcoming championship qualifier, ahead of Forbidden Door.

With the AEW and NJPW crossover event taking place on August 24 at The O2 in London, England, Nigel McGuinness will have the opportunity to earn his way onto the show taking place in his home country.

McGuinness will be one of four stars competing in the IWGP World Heavyweight Title #1 contender’s four-way on the August 16 Collision episode, with either McGuinness, Hechicero, Lee Moriarty or Daniel Garcia to challenge for Zack Sabre Jr’s gold at Forbidden Door.

Nigel McGuinness has now taken to Twitter to address this four-way announcement, noting that he won’t let this opportunity slip away.

The AEW announcer wrote:

“Leaving this here – steep training curve – but I’m leaving everything in the ring to take this opportunity…”

This four-way will be Nigel McGuinness’ fifth match since returning to the ring after over 12 years away in the Casino Gauntlet match at All In London 2024.

His most recent bout saw him and Daniel Garcia lose to Cash Wheeler and Dax Harwood of FTR at Double or Nothing in May.
